The bush Pet dog is In close proximity to Threatened. Agricultural land conversion has destroyed Considerably of their habitat by developing large areas of arable land or monoculture woodlands. This habitat degradation and poaching has also decreased The supply of their prey species. Bush dogs are occasionally killed by domestic dogs, which also distribute condition that they've got not Beforehand been subjected to.
They're remarkably social animals that live and hunt in packs, demonstrating cooperative breeding and a fancy social composition.

Bush dogs have a distinctive look that sets them other than other canids. They may have small, sturdy legs and also a squat overall body that provides them a somewhat bear-like visual appeal. Their fur is dense and reddish-brown, fading into a paler reddish hue on The pinnacle, neck, and back, which gives exceptional camouflage while in the dense vegetation of their habitats.
